I Belong: Stories on Resurrection & Belonging - Eastertide Devotional
In a time marked by polarization, injustice, and deep questions about who truly belongs, “I Belong: Stories on Resurrection & Belonging” devotional series offers a sacred counter-witness. We invited contributors from across our richly diverse United Methodist connection to share personal stories of belonging—moments when they encountered radical welcome, spiritual homecoming, holy affirmation, or healing made possible through community.
Each reflection, paired with scripture, prayer and a practice of belonging, becomes an act of resistance against the forces that divide us. Together, these daily testimonies guide us from the promise of Easter Resurrection toward the Spirit-filled vision of a Pentecost Church where every person is seen, valued, and embraced.
This series is designed to:
Cultivate a theologically rooted understanding of belonging as a spiritual practice and a justice commitment
Amplify diverse voices and lived experiences across the UMC, especially in a season when marginalized communities continue to face threats to their dignity and safety.
Inspire daily actions of inclusion, courage, and solidarity, nurturing communities that embody God’s vision of justice and beloved community.
In a world where exclusion is loud, these reflections remind us that God’s welcome is louder—and that building a Church and society where all belong is holy work for our time.
